The emergence of India as an economic superpower has challenged business leaders to learn all they can about the fastest-growing economy in the world. What better way to do so than to observe India’s high achievers ?

From fields as diverse as biotechnology, entertainment and green energy, Pota profiles ten of India’s movers and shakers, including Narayana Murthy, Chairman of Infosys; K V Kamath, Chairman of ICICI Bank; and role model Kiran Mazumdar Shaw, who broke through the male-dominated Indian business world to become Chairwoman of Biocon India, Asia’s largest biotechnology company. India Inc. sifts through the jargon, dusts off the myths and spells out in simple terms what the future holds for the country and the world at large.

Pota proves that India is well on its way to providing the next set of role models—to follow Bill Gates, Richard Branson and Warren Buffet—revealing who those business leaders are and what makes them tick.
